Output 50699e5c04af4bb2661611d76a98515410fb86d670121ab182150917acd20a35:5

value
17000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1438030234d7e0f28408a5a7eac4b4dee508be OP_EQUAL
address
3BYV864Jtnq2eGFDSGPusHbAtfjuipXKKx
transaction
50699e5c04af4bb2661611d76a98515410fb86d670121ab182150917acd20a35
spent
true